Christmas Holiday Ornaments

                      printer-friendly version

An assortment for holiday decorating –

angel, Christmas flower, wreath, tasseled diamond

 

Skill Level: Easy-Intermediate

Size:  2-1/2" to 4" high

Materials:

Note: sample thread ornaments shown in Coats & Clark “Knit-Cro-Sheen” ;

sample yarn ornaments shown in Plymouth Yarns “Encore”

Small amounts of sport or DK-wt. yarn in red, green, white

1 ball size 10 crochet thread in gold with gold metallic accent

1 ball size 10 crochet thread in white with silver metallic accent

One 1" cabone ring (for wreath)

2 small jingle bells, 5 tiny red pompoms, 4 small red faceted beads for trims

Crochet hooks sizes D/3 (3.25 mm), E/4 (3.5 mm), F/5 (3.75 mm)

Tapestry needle

 

Gauge: not critical for this project

Stitches/Terms:  beginning (beg), chain (ch), double crochet (dc), repeat (rep), round (rnd), single crochet (sc), triple crochet (trc), stitch (st)

Pattern notes: Angel and tasseled diamond ornaments are worked with 2 strands #10 crochet cotton thread held together as one.  Christmas flower and wreath are worked in single strand of yarn.

 

Angel Ornament

Use double strand white/silver metallic crochet cotton & size E/4 (3.5 mm) hook

 

Head & Wings:

 

Rnd 1: Ch 4, join into ring, work 11 dc in ring, join with sl st to top of beg chain (12 dc)

 

Rnd 2: Ch 1, sc in same st, sc in next 2 dc, ch 12 (halo), skip 3 dc, sc in next 3 dc, 2 sc in next 2 dc, join with sl st (10 sc + ch-12 halo).  Turn and work in rows for remainder of ornament:

 

Row 3: Ch 3, 5 dc in same st, dc in next 10 dc, 6 dc in top of last st (the beginning ch-3), turn (22 dc)

 

Row 4:  Ch 3, (dc, hdc, sc) all in same st as beg ch-3, sc in next 20 dc, (sc, hdc, 2dc) all in top of last st (top of beg ch-3), fasten off (28 sts) (head & wings completed)

 

Skirt:

 

Turn head/wings piece upside down.

 

Row 1: Reattach yarn in 11th sc from tip of wing, ch3, dc in same st, 2 dc in ea of next 6 dc, turn (14 dc)

 

Row 2: Ch 3, dc in next dc, *ch 1, skip 1 dc, 2 dc in next dc, rep from * across, ending with ch 1, skip 1 dc, 2 dc in top of beg ch-3, turn (14 dc, 6 ch-1 sps)

 

Row 3: Ch 3, dc in ea dc and sp across, turn (20 dc)

 

Row 4: Ch 3, dc in same st, *ch 2, skip 1 dc, 2 dc in next dc, rep from * across to last 3 sts, ch 2, skip 1 dc, dc in next dc, dc in top of beg ch-3, turn (20 dc, 9 ch-2 sps)

 

Edging: Ch 1, sc in same st, ch 3, dc in same st, *sc in next sp, ch 3, dc in same sp, rep from * across to last 2 dc, skip next dc, sc in top of beg ch-3. Fasten off and weave in ends.

 

Finishing: Lightly stiffen angel with diluted glue/water mixture, lay on waxed paper or plastic wrap, shape and let dry completely.   Attach length of gold crochet thread to top of halo for hanger.

 

Christmas Flower Ornament

Use green, red, white yarn & size F/5 (3.75 mm) hook

 

Note:  Make 2 pieces the same for front & back of ornament as follows:

 

Rnd 1: Ch 4, join into ring, work 11 dc in ring, join with sl st, fasten off green (12 dc)

 

Rnd 2: Attach red to top of any dc, ch 3, dc in same dc, 2 dc in ea dc around, join with sl st, fasten off red (24 dc)

 

Edging:  Hold front and back pieces of ornament with wrong sides together, then work through the inner loop of each piece and attach edging as follows:

 

Attach white to top of any dc, inserting hook through both layers to join front piece to back piece.  Ch 1, sc in same st, ch 3, dc in same st, *sc in next st, ch 3, dc in same st, rep from * around, join with sl st, fasten off white.  Weave in loose ends. 

 

Finishing: Attach length of gold crochet thread for hanger.  Attach small jingle bell to center of flower on each side, if desired.

 

Wreath Ornament

Use green yarn/gold crochet cotton held together & size F/5 (3.75 mm) hook

 

Rnd 1: Insert hook into cabone ring, yo and pull loop through ring, ch 1, sc evenly around ring until covered (about 20 sc), join with sl st (20 sc)

 

Rnd 2: Ch 3, 4 dc in same sc, drop loop from hook, reinsert hook in top of beg ch-3 and through top 2 loops of last dc worked, yo and pull loop through to form popcorn st, ch 1 to fasten top of popcorn, ch 1, skip 1 sc, *popcorn in next sc, ch 1, rep from * around, join with sl st to top of beg popcorn (10 popcorns, or 1/2 the number of sc made on Rnd 1)

 

Rnd 3: Ch 1, sc in top of same popcorn, sc in next ch-1 sp between popcorns, ch 3, dc in same sp, *sc in top of next pc, ch 3, dc in same pc, sc in next ch-1 sp, ch 3, dc in same sp, rep from * around, join with sl st, fasten off.  Attach gold thread hanger. Glue on tiny red pompoms at random to represent berries.

 

Diamond Tasseled Ornament

Use double strand gold/gold metallic and white/silver metallic size 10 crochet cotton thread & size D/3 (3.25 mm) hook

 

Rnd 1:  With double strand gold/gold metallic crochet cotton, ch 8, join into ring.  Holding back last loop on hook as you form 3-dc clusters, ch 3, 2 dc in ring (beg cluster made), ch 3, *3-dc cluster in ring, ch 3, rep from * six times, join with sl st to top of beg cluster (eight 3-dc clusters, eight ch-3 sps)

 

Rnd 2: Sl st to first ch-3 sp, ch 1, 3 sc in ea sp and 1 sc in top of ea 3-dc cluster around, join with sl st, fasten off gold (32 sc)

 

Rnd 3: Join white/silver metallic double strand in any sc directly above center of 3-dc cluster, ch 1, sc in same sc, sc in next 3 sc, hdc in next sc, *(2dc, ch2, 2 dc) in next sc (corner made), hdc in next sc, sc in next 5 sc, hdc in next sc, rep from * around, ending sc in last 2 sc, join with sl st, fasten off white/silver (four corners made with 5 sc between ea corner).

 

Rnd 4: Join gold/gold metallic double strand in center sc on any side, ch 1, sc in same sc, sc in ea sc to first corner, *sc in corner, ch 6, sc in 3rd ch from hook (picot made), ch 4, sc in same corner, sc across to next corner, rep from * around, ending with sc to beg of round, join with sl st, fasten off and weave in ends.  Attach gold thread hanger to one corner picot loop.

 

Tassel & Finishing:

 

Holding 2 strands gold/gold metallic tog with 2 strands white/silver metallic, wind thread around 4" length of cardboard 5 times.  With a separate double strand of thread, tie one end of wrapped strands tog at top, leaving long ends to attach tassel to ornament.  Cut lower end of tassel strands, remove cardboard.  At 1/2 " from top of tassel, wrap separate length of thread several times around to form head of tassel, tie off and bury ends inside tassel strands. Trim strands evenly at bottom end of tassel.  Tie tassel to corner picot loop at bottom of ornament. 

 

Lightly stiffen ornament with diluted glue/water mixture (as on angel), lay flat on waxed paper, pull points into shape, let dry completely.  Glue on 4 small red faceted beads to each corner of diamond as shown in photo.
